April 4, 1935 - June 9, 2018
Luke Thompson, 83, was born in Trent Texas
April 4, 1935 and died at his home, in Roswell New Mexico, on June 9, 2018.
He was raised in Big Springs, Texas where he graduated high school and
attended Big Springs Community College. He also attended Waco University before
being drafted in the United States Army in 1956.
Luke is survived by his
ex-wife Pat Thompson of Roswell NM, son Robert Thompson and daughter-in-law
Dayle of Roswell NM. He has two Grandchildren, Amber Thompson of Manhattan KS
and Justin Thompson of Avondale AZ. Also brother-in-law Ireland McCormick and
sister-in-law Gearline Thompson, along with nieces and nephews.
Luke is
preceded in death by his parents, Beulah Henson Thompson and Julian Murdock
Thompson and his siblings JW Thompson and Jueldeen McCormick.
During his
adult life, Luke was fortunate to enjoy his passion every day as a Golf
Professional, running various Country Clubs around the Southwest, including his
final location at Roswell Country Club. He taught many people, including
children how to play golf and was a very talented instructor. When not at work,
Luke enjoyed raising and riding quarter horses with his wife and son.
